Surnames: Canales, Trueheart, Saldana, Salinas Classification: Query Message Board URL: http://boards.ancestry.com/mbexec/msg/rw/GhB.2ACE/955.1 Message Board Post: Located death record Robert Curran b. June 20, 1843, Kingston, Ont. d. Jan 2, 1925, San Benito, Cameron, Texas Cause of death: sudden death, acute cardiac dilitation Male/widowed Informant: F.A.G. Curran of San Benito Occupation: Farmer Age: 81 years, 6 months, 13 days Residence: 2 years in San Benito Burial: Jan 4, 1925, Brownsville, Texas Undertaker: H. T. Stother of Mercedes, Hidalgo Co., Texas Father: Robert Curran born Ireland Mother: not known, born Ireland FHL # 2113743 Cert. # 694 You can order the film at a local Family History Library and view and copy the certificate. Unfortunately, the certificate does not say which cemetery he is buried. It just says Brownsville. But there are two cemeteries and he is likely buried in one of those two. Brownsville City Cemetery-call City Hall Buena Vista Burial Park You can search on line for telephone numbers and try the funeral home of Stother in Mercedes, Hidalgo, Texas These two cemeteries are very large and the names are not anywhere available that I know.
